The transcript narrates a story about a person with a crooked tooth who is teased by friends. Their father encourages them to smile and embrace their uniqueness, explaining that a smile makes a face radiant. The narrator learns to appreciate their unique feature and shares this insight with their teacher and classmates, turning it into a secret that bonds them.
